ReactOS 0.4.15-dev-7934-g1dc8d80
usbprint.h File Reference

Go to the source code of this file.

Macros

#define USBPRINT_IOCTL_INDEX   0x0000
 
#define IOCTL_USBPRINT_GET_LPT_STATUS    CTL_CODE(FILE_DEVICE_UNKNOWN, USBPRINT_IOCTL_INDEX+12, METHOD_BUFFERED, FILE_ANY_ACCESS)
 
#define IOCTL_USBPRINT_GET_1284_ID    CTL_CODE(FILE_DEVICE_UNKNOWN, USBPRINT_IOCTL_INDEX+13, METHOD_BUFFERED, FILE_ANY_ACCESS)
 
#define IOCTL_USBPRINT_VENDOR_SET_COMMAND    CTL_CODE(FILE_DEVICE_UNKNOWN, USBPRINT_IOCTL_INDEX+14, METHOD_BUFFERED, FILE_ANY_ACCESS)
 
#define IOCTL_USBPRINT_VENDOR_GET_COMMAND    CTL_CODE(FILE_DEVICE_UNKNOWN, USBPRINT_IOCTL_INDEX+15, METHOD_BUFFERED, FILE_ANY_ACCESS)
 
#define IOCTL_USBPRINT_SOFT_RESET    CTL_CODE(FILE_DEVICE_UNKNOWN, USBPRINT_IOCTL_INDEX+16, METHOD_BUFFERED, FILE_ANY_ACCESS)
 

Macro Definition Documentation

◆ IOCTL_USBPRINT_GET_1284_ID

Definition at line 6 of file usbprint.h.

◆ IOCTL_USBPRINT_GET_LPT_STATUS

Definition at line 3 of file usbprint.h.

◆ IOCTL_USBPRINT_SOFT_RESET

Definition at line 15 of file usbprint.h.

◆ IOCTL_USBPRINT_VENDOR_GET_COMMAND

Definition at line 12 of file usbprint.h.

◆ IOCTL_USBPRINT_VENDOR_SET_COMMAND

Definition at line 9 of file usbprint.h.

◆ USBPRINT_IOCTL_INDEX

#define USBPRINT_IOCTL_INDEX   0x0000

Definition at line 1 of file usbprint.h.